Ancient cave monastery complex discovered in Sataniv, Ukraine

news.telegraf.com.ua (Ukrainian)

A thousand-year-old cave monastery complex, possibly founded by monks, has been discovered in Sataniv, Ukraine. The cave, part of the Holy Trinity Monastery, features natural and man-made chambers including a corridor, cells, and a church, with evidence suggesting it dates back to the Middle Ages. Legends attribute its founding to monks from Mount Athos or Kyiv, though these are unconfirmed. The monastery is documented from at least the 16th century.
